/* CSS Document */

* {
	margin:0; padding:0;
}

body { background:#f9f6f1; }

a:hover{text-decoration:none;}

a img { border:0;}

ul { list-style:none;}

.left { float:left;}
.right {float:right;}
.clear  { clear:both;}

html, input, textarea
	{
		font-family:Tahoma; 
		font-size:12px;
		line-height:16px;
		color:#685c4c;		
	}

input, select { vertical-align:middle; font-weight:normal; color:#856846;}

a {color:#4a3330;}

/*main layout */

#header .indent {padding:1px 29px 0 29px;}
#header .logo {
	background:url(images/header_bg_new4.jpg) top left no-repeat;
	padding-top: 8px;
	padding-right: 0;
	padding-bottom: 55px;
	padding-left: 40px;
}
#header .logo_sub {padding:50px 0 65px 40px; background:url(images/header_bg.jpg) top left no-repeat;}
#header .logoRes {padding:8px 0 115px 40px; background:url(images/logoNew_tagline.gif) top left no-repeat;}
#header a {color:#FFFFFF; text-decoration:none;}
#main { margin:0 auto;}

#marquee {padding:20px 0px 20px 0px; text-align:center; font-size:18px; font-weight:bold;}

#middle {padding:0 28px 0 29px;}

.box {background:url(images/box_btall.gif) bottom repeat-x #ffffff;}
.box .ttall {background:url(images/box_ttall.gif) top repeat-x;}
.box .rtall {background:url(images/box_rtall.gif) right repeat-y;}
.box .ltall {background:url(images/box_ltall.gif) left repeat-y;}
.box .bleft {background:url(images/box_bl.gif) bottom left no-repeat;}
.box .bright {background:url(images/box_br.gif) bottom right no-repeat;}
.box .tleft {background:url(images/box_tl.gif) top left no-repeat;}
.box .tright {background:url(images/box_tr.gif) top right no-repeat; width:100%;}
.box .indent {
	padding-top: 3px;
	padding-right: 15px;
	padding-bottom: 13px;
	padding-left: 13px;
}
/* NOTE USED PER 04/2009 UPGRADE .box .inner_bg {background:url(images/inner_box_bg.gif) top left no-repeat; width:100%;} */
.box .content {padding:1px 13px 1px 30px;}

.more {background:url(images/list_bg.gif) no-repeat 0 5px; padding-left:8px; color:#8d7252;}

#footer .column1 {width:620px; padding-top:25px; color:#b8aea0;}
#footer .column1 .padding {padding:6px 0 6px 54px;}
#footer .column1 .bg {background:url(images/footer_line.gif) no-repeat 308px 0; width:100%;}
#footer a {color:#b8aea0;}
#footer .column2 {width:200px; padding-top:25px; color:#9b8b7a;}
#footer .column2 .padding {padding:6px 0 0 0;}
#footer .column2 a {color:#a79a89;}
#footer .column3 {width:700px; padding-top:25px; color:#9b8b7a;}
#footer .column3 .padding {padding:6px 0 0 0;}
#footer .column3 a {color:#a79a89;}

.line {background:#f0ede9; height:1px;}
.s_text {color:#7b7055;}
li { background:url(images/list_bg.gif) no-repeat 0 7px; padding-left:14px; line-height:20px;}
li a {color:#7b7055; text-decoration:none;}
li a:hover {text-decoration:underline;}

.block {height:20px; background:url(images/block_bg.gif) bottom repeat-x; color:#7b7055;}
.block .left {background:#FFFFFF;}
.block a {color:#7b7055; text-decoration:none;}
.block a:hover {font-weight:bold;}
.block .right {background:#FFFFFF;}

.listingImage {border:1px solid #61504c;}

/* index - HomePage*/

#index .box .content {
	padding-top: 1px;
	padding-right: 13px;
	padding-bottom: 7px;
	padding-left: 0px;
}
.box .indent { padding-top: 13px; }
#index .box .inner_bg {background:url(images/mainPageBkgd.gif) top left no-repeat; width:100%;}
#index #middle .column1 {padding-left:12px; padding-top:7px;}
#index #middle .column2 .text {padding: 14px 0 0 0px; margin-right:5px;}
#index #middle .column3 .text {padding:20px 0px 0px 0px; text-align:center; font-size:16px; font-weight:bold;}

/* fullPages */

#fullPages .box .content {padding:15px 13px 7px 30px;}
#fullPages #middle .column1 .padding {padding:12px 0 0 0;}
#fullPages #middle .column2 .padding {padding:12px 0 0 0;}
#fullPages .column3 {width:565px; color:#9b8b7a;}
#fullPages .column3 .padding {padding:6px 0 0 0;}
#fullPages .column3 a {color:#a79a89;}


/* locations - All Location Pages  */

#locations #header {height:170px;}
#locations #header .logo { background:url(images/logoNew_tagline.gif) top left no-repeat; }

#locations .box .content {padding:15px 13px 14px 30px;}

#locations #middle .column1 .padding {padding:5px 0px 0px 0px;}
#locations #middle .column2 .padding {padding:5px 0 0 0;}

#locations #middle .column1 .text {padding:0 0 0 1px;}
#locations #middle .column2 .text {padding:0 0 0 2px;}

#locations #middle .rentalLinks {padding:20px 20px 0px 25px; background:url(images/linkBkgd.jpg) top left no-repeat; width:100%; text-align:center; font-size:16px; font-weight:bold;}

/* location_res - All Location Reservation Page */

#locations_res #middle .column1 {padding:0px 0px 0px 0px;}


/* index-3 */

#index_3 .box .content {padding:15px 13px 16px 30px;}
#index_3 .line {margin-right:12px;}

#index_3 #middle .column1 .padding {padding:12px 0 0 0;}
#index_3 #middle .column2 .padding {padding:12px 0 0 0;}

#index_3 #middle .column1 ul {margin:12px 0 0 13px;}

#index_3 #middle .column1 .text {padding:0 0 0 1px;}
#index_3 #middle .column2 .text {padding:6px 0 0 23px;}

#index_3 #middle .column1 .col1 {width:151px;}
#index_3 #middle .column1 .col2 {width:151px;}
#index_3 #middle .column1 .ind_col {width:27px;}

/* index-4 */

#index_4 .box .content {padding:15px 13px 0 30px;}

#index_4 #middle .column1 .padding {padding:12px 0 0 0;}
#index_4 #middle .column2 .padding {padding:12px 0 0 0;}

#index_4 #middle .column2 .text {padding:0 0 0 10px;}
#index_4 #middle .column2 ul {margin-left:122px;}


#index_4 #middle .column1 .col1 {width:116px; font-size:10px;}
#index_4 #middle .column1 .col2 {width:90px; font-size:10px;}
#index_4 form { color:#856846;}
#index_4 form .row {height:45px;}
#index_4 form .row1 {height:29px;}

#index_4 .input {width:197px; height:17px; padding:0 0 0 5px;}
#index_4 .select {width:90px;}
#index_4 form .div {text-align:right; padding:1px 1px 0 0;}

/* index-5 */

#index_5 .box .content {padding:18px 13px 3px 30px;}
#index_5 .line {margin-right:12px;}

#index_5 #middle .column1 .padding {padding:12px 0 0 0;}
#index_5 #middle .column2 .padding {padding:12px 0 0 0;}

#index_5 #middle .column2 .text {padding:0 4px 0 2px;}

#index_5 #middle .column1 .col1 {width:162px;}
#index_5 #middle .column1 .col2 {width:158px;}

#index_5 form .row {height:26px;}
#index_5 form .row1 {height:65px;}

textarea {width:153px; height:43px; padding:0 0 0 2px; overflow:auto; color:#856846;}
#index_5 form .input {width:154px; height:17px; padding:0 0 0 2px;}
#index_5 form .div {text-align:right; padding:0;}

/* index-6 */

#index_6 .box .content {padding:27px 13px 8px 30px;}

/* -------------- STYLES NEW ----------------- */

.boxRental {
    background: #E4E4E4 url(/images/rf/box.gif) no-repeat;
    width: 750px;
    height: 100px;
    margin: 0 0 10px 0;
    padding: 0;
}
